Example

Let’s say your body weight is 70 kilograms, and you’ve exercised for 45 minutes. Using the formula FW=(BW∗0.033)+(E∗0.001), your recommended daily water intake would be:

FW = (70 kg * 0.033) + (45 minutes * 0.001) = 2.31 liters.

So, in this example, you should aim to drink approximately 2.31 liters of water daily to stay adequately hydrated.

FAQs 

1. Why is staying hydrated important?

  • Proper hydration is essential for overall health, as it helps maintain bodily functions, regulate body temperature, and support various metabolic processes.

2. Can I use this calculator for hot weather alone, without exercise?

  • Yes, you can. Simply input the duration of your exposure to hot weather in the “Exercise/Hot Weather” field, and the calculator will provide your recommended water intake accordingly.

3. Is it okay to drink more water than the calculated amount?

  • It’s generally safe to drink a bit more water than the calculated amount, but excessive water intake can lead to water intoxication. It’s essential to strike a balance and listen to your body’s signals.

4. What if I don’t know my exact body weight in kilograms?

  • If you’re unsure about your precise weight in kilograms, you can convert it from pounds to kilograms using the formula: 1 pound = 0.453592 kilograms.
